Where does “peruuntua” come from?
peruuntua (Finnish) comes from Finnish -Vntua, from Finnish -untua, from Finnish -ntua, from Finnish -ua, from Proto-Finnic -üdäk — Forms mainly passive or anticausative verbs.
peruuntua (Finnish): to be canceled, be withdrawn, be called off, be revoked
